Abstract

The invention discloses a method for installing a front beam and a rear beam of an extruder with a short construction period and a simple structure, comprising the following steps: A, installing a reinforced steel column in a basement located on one side of a concrete foundation; , Install a reinforced column between the fixed platform and the basement roof, and the reinforced column and the reinforced steel column are arranged coaxially; install the connecting column between the fixed platform and the concrete foundation; install the mobile platform and several rolling steel pipes on the fixed platform from top to bottom Above; C, connect the first towing hook and the second towing hook through the chain block; the length direction of the rolling steel pipe is perpendicular to the pulling direction of the chain block; D, the front beam and the rear beam placed on the mobile platform , through the hand chain hoist to move from the starting point to the installation end, until it is pulled to the respective installation position, to be in place. It is easy to make, easy to operate, low in construction cost, simplifies the installation process of the front crossbeam and the rear crossbeam of the extrusion machine in a restricted environment, and has little safety risk.

technical field [0001] The invention relates to the technical field of mechanical equipment installation, in particular to a method for installing a front beam and a rear beam of an extrusion machine. Background technique [0002] Metal extrusion machine, hereinafter referred to as: extrusion machine, usually installed on the concrete foundation, is the most important equipment to realize metal extrusion processing, and is to process metal ingots into tubes, rods, profiles, etc. at one time. The extrusion machine is mainly composed of three major parts: mechanical part, hydraulic part and electrical part. Among them, the mechanical part is composed of base, prestressed frame type tension column, front beam, movable beam, rear beam, extrusion shaft, ingot feeding mechanism, residual material separation shear and sliding mold base, etc. [0003] Due to the mass and volume of the extruder, auxiliary equipment is usually required during the installation of the extruder.
